Murphy is recruiting for a
Data Analyst delivering major water infrastructure projects in partnership with multiple clients across the UK.
We provide end-to-end services for major water and sewage companies such as Thames Water, Severn Trent Water, Northern Ireland Water, Yorkshire Water and United Utilities, and for several water-only companies including SES Water, Bristol Water and South East Water.
We also provide a full design, build, operate and maintain service for Uisce Éireann and we currently operate over 25 of their facilities, ensuring they run efficiently and comply fully with EPA regulations.
A day in the life of a Murphy Data Analyst
- Working closely with business reporting stakeholders to understanding reporting and analytical requirements to acquire and present relevant datasets.
- Handle large and complex datasets from Primavera P6, SAP Success Factors and other key construction centric systems.
- Verify the integrity of extracted data.
- Awareness of, and support embedding and applying revised Data Governance and Information Security standards and best practices.
- Applying Murphy best practices to code management, documentation and release.
- Help establish good working practices for the work delivered.
- Working as part of the Planning and Project Controls Function, alongside the Resource Management Team.
- Project work to be allocated as required, during the duration of the project.
- Liaising with planners, operational staff and other technical staff.
- Assisting with the designing of maintenance procedures and putting them into operation.
- Providing user training, support and feedback as required.
- Build effective relationships with all relevant stakeholders.
- Provide support and guidance to other team members.
- Attend sites to assist remote application users as required.
- Ad hoc activities as deemed appropriate by the Head of Planning.
- Design and develop applications and workflows using POwer apps and Power Automate to streamline and automate business data processes.
- Debugging, testing and troubleshooting systems and applications
Still interested, does this sound like you?
- Detailed knowledge and practical experience with Primavera P6 and Power BI, Power Automate, Power Apps, Dataverse
- Experienced with connecting disparate data sources, particularly: Dataverse, Sharepoint, P6
- Write and maintain python scripts for data processing, backend logic, API integration and workflow automation
- Integrate python processes with Power Platforms solutions
- Demonstrable experience with Visual Studio and Azure Dev Ops toolsets.
- Working knowledge of ETL and data ingestion (API knowledge).
- Solutions architecture
- Understanding of relational databases and data modelling
- Experience within construction and/or civil engineering processes and applications.
- Happy to travel nationwide across multitude of Murphy projects
